Origins and Family

Lydia Zakrevski was born on +1826-06-18T00:00:00Z[2]. Her father was Arseny Zakrevsky[4]. Her mother was Agrafena Sakrevskaya (née Tolstoy)[5].

Personal Life

Spouses include Dmitry Nesselrode[6], a diplomat[20], 1816–1891[21], of Russian Empire[22], awarded the senior chamberlain[23] and Dmitry Drutskoy-Sokolinksy[7], 1832–1906[24], of Russian Empire[25], awarded the Order of Saint Stanislaus, 3rd class[26]. Children include Anatol Graf von Nesselrode[8], a jurist[27], 1850–1923[28]; Mariya Drutskaya-Sokolinskaya[9], 1859–1940[29], of Kingdom of Italy[30]; and Arseny Drutskoy-Sokolinsky[10], 1862–1912[31], of Russian Empire[32].
